Homework Statement



A warehouse worker applies a force of 420 N to push two crates across the floor. One crate is 30kg and the other is 40kg. The boxes are touching each other.

The friction forces opposing the motion of the crates is a constant 2.0N for each kilogram..

Edit: The question is; Calculate the force exerted by the 40kg crate on the 30 kg crate

Draw a force diagram (it doesn't have to be very complicated) with the force exerted by the warehouse worker on the boxes in one direction and the total force of the resistive friction in the other (as these are opposing forces). Since the two boxes are touching each other, you can view them as a single entity.

What is the total friction for the system? How can you use this, in light of your diagram, to calculate the force of box 'a' on box 'b'?
